“Don’t talk too much later. Just follow me closely!” Song Junlang looked very carefree. His skill was not that high, especially when faced with the guards that even included a dragon.
Yet, from the time they entered, no one dared to stop them. Every guard that tried to stop them would look like a frightened cat the moment they saw Song Junlang, and quietly move away.
They faced no obstructions the entire way, and Xiao Lin felt quite shocked. He felt like those people might actually not recognize Song Junlang, after all he was only the Logistics Department Head for the last two years. Those of them who graduated before then might not even know what Song Junlang’s name was. Yet, they still did not dare to stop him. Xiao Lin could not help but glance at that unassuming emblem in front of Song Junlang’s chest, and could not help but whisper in a half-joking tone.
“What kind of emblem is that? It looks quite useful; why don’t you give me one?”
“Alright, as long as you’re willing to come to my experiment room. I can even give you a dozen,” Song Junlang teased as well.
“Then forget it.” Song Junlang’s experiment room was as good as a tiger’s den in Xiao Lin’s eyes.
“… Are you not going to consider it? This emblem is very useful. Have you ever heard about a golden immunity plate from ancient times? It regularly features in dramas. With just one plate in hand, everything goes much more smoothly. This thing is pretty much the same,” Song Junlang said half-seriously.
“Where did you scam it out of?” Xiao Lin asked suspiciously.
“Hey, why did you say I scammed it!”
“Some of the guards I saw earlier seem to have left,” Xiao Lin suddenly said after turning his head around.
“Yes, probably to look for someone. They don’t dare to stop me, but I have no way of stopping them from summoning someone either,” Song Junlang said, having foreseen everything.

“Then what do we do?”
“Hurry up; even though I’m not afraid of anyone, it’s never a good thing to cause a scene. This is already violating my principle of keeping a low profile.”
“You, keeping a low profile…” The corner of Xiao Lin’s lips twitched.
The treatment room was not in Dawn City; it was at a cave over a dozen kilometers away from the city. The cave had completely been dug out. Rumor had it that, during the first war against the orcs, it used to be a military warehouse. It had been abandoned after the war, and was perfectly suited for a quarantined treatment room.
When they reached the deepest part of the cave, outside a stone room, a man and a woman blocked them. This time, they did not wear any armor, but both of them had large blades glimmering with elemental energy. Song Junlang’s smiled. “I never expected the final guards to be the two of you. When did you come back?”
The two of them looked at each other before the middle-aged woman said in a magnetic voice, “We rushed back the moment we heard about the ambush on the dean. We heard some commotion earlier… I never expected it to be you. It’s been awhile, Monitor Song.”
“These are my old classmates.” Song Junlang explained to Xiao Lin, but did not introduce Xiao Lin to the other two. However, they smiled as they observed Xiao Lin before the man furrowed his eyebrows and said, “Is he the new student the dean mentioned before?”
“Who else would it be, but since the old fart made the two of you guard this place, I guess he never planned on stopping it. I shouldn’t have brought the emblem here.”
Song Junlang sighed, seemingly disappointed at his miscalculation. Looking at Xiao Lin, who was sweating, he did not explain when he pushed Xiao Lin into the stone room as he said, “Go meet the dean. We’ll stand guard here.”
Xiao Lin stumbled into the narrow stone room; the small room only had a large light blue orb in the middle. The orb had taken up most of the space in the room, and was floating in the air. Other than that, there was no one and no other objects to be seen.

Xiao Lin felt that it was strange, and could not help but reach out to touch it. He immediately felt a very strong suction coming from the orb. The orb soundlessly cracked open in the middle, and a row of stairs appeared. Xiao Lin followed the stairs into the space within, and the orb closed behind him.
Inside the orb was a completely isolated space, and in the warm white glow, there was a white bed. On it was a serene looking old man.
It was the dean.
Xiao Lin rushed over, but he was blocked by an invisible membrane a few meters away from the bed. He angrily began to hit it, and even wanted to pull out his Holy Sword to break it.

“Ah, that’s useless. If my shield was so easily broken by you, then I would lose all my dignity!” the old dean teased.
Xiao Lin gaped, “You erected it?”
“The curse I was inflicted by is very special, and we’re not sure if it’s infectious, so this is for your own good.” The dean had a white patient’s outfit on. He sat up in bed, but did not stand. He seemed to have more wrinkles on his face, and looked a lot older. In truth, in terms of age, that old man was already a few hundred years old; it was just that his strength meant that no one dared to treat him like an old man.
“Can the curse be undone? I know some people from the dark clans that might be able to help.” The calmer the dean was, the more Xiao Lin’s heart ached, and the more he tried to solve the problem.
The dean smiled as he shook his head. “Are you referring to the dark races who stay in the Rosa Kingdom? Back then, even Ivanovich did not succeed. This curse is currently incurable.”
Xiao Lin suddenly remembered that the St. Claude clan had met Ivanovich before, but the dean’s words contained an even more shocking secret, which made Xiao Lin cry out in shock, “Dean, do you mean that Ivanovich had died to this curse as well? Who is the one harming you in the shadows?”
The dean smiled, seemingly having accepted death. “That’s no longer important. What’s happened has happened, and nothing will change the truth no matter how much we investigate. Xiao Lin, I don’t think you came to see me for a matter as trivial as who the assailant was, right?”
Xiao Lin fell silent. He obviously knew he could not do something like that with just himself. After composing himself, he prepared to tell the dean everything that happened in the royal city.
Yet, the dean raised his hand to stop Xiao Lin, saying, “You don’t have to waste your breath, I already know of everything that happened in the royal city.”
Xiao Lin was perplexed and astonished.
The dean explained, “Astrology can somewhat predict the future with certain special methods, and I already had someone use astrology to predict the matter.”
“Then do you know where Asabanor currently is?”
“That’s impossible. Astrology is not omnipotent, and Asabanor himself is a very strong astrologian. If you have the time, you can head to the library to understand the art; I think it will help you… Ah, we’re going off topic. This time, I want to talk to you about the future — Planet Norma’s future, the future of the colonists, as well as the future of Earth.”
